Dashboards is its own page, in the left navigation directly under Companies. Open it and you get a board you build yourself, by asking. Describe the number you care about in plain words and Current draws it as a gauge, a leaderboard, a trend line, or whichever shape reads best. It used to be the first tab on Reports; if that is where you look for it, the old link still brings you here. Reports keeps its seven lenses (Overview, Delivery, Effort, Budget, Resources, Risk, and Profitability) and opens on Overview.

It is a staff surface. Anyone on your team who can open Dashboards can build one for themselves. Partners never see it, so nothing you build here can reach the portal.

Building your first tile

SCREENSHOT — coming soon
The Dashboards page: the timeframe bar across the top, with your tiles below it.
  1. 1
    Open Dashboards
    It is in the left navigation, directly under Companies. Quick search finds it too: press the search shortcut and type dashboard, or wallboard. A link you saved to the old Dashboard tab on Reports brings you straight here.
  2. 2
    Describe the number you want
    Click Add a tile and type it the way you would say it out loud. Tickets we closed this week. Won revenue this quarter by rep. Hours logged this week by person. On an empty dashboard the sample prompts sit right there as chips, filtered to the integrations you actually have connected, to the PSA you run, and to what your role can see, so anything you click is something Current will build. Clicking a chip lands you straight in Edit tile with a live preview, no questions asked. Prefer a whole board at once? Start from a set offers ready-made boards for the service desk, sales and leadership, trimmed to what your workspace can actually draw, and tells you when a set arrives smaller than advertised and why.
  3. 3
    Answer the three questions
    Type your own request and Current always asks three short questions about it, composed to fit what you asked: which product it should pull from, which ticket queues it counts, what window it covers, how it breaks down. Each one offers three suggested answers to click plus a box to type your own. Answering is optional on every one, so you can answer none of them and carry on. Start over clears the round and puts you back at the box. The starter chips on an empty dashboard skip the questions entirely: those are already worked out, so Current builds straight from them.
  4. 4
    Pick one of the tiles Current drew
    Next you get up to three finished tiles side by side, each drawn with your own numbers rather than a picture of what one might look like. They are read by your browser under your own permissions, so what you see is what you would get. Click the one you want, or move between them with the arrow keys. Start over goes back to the box.
  5. 5
    Finish the tile, then add it
    The last step is the tile itself with a live preview beside it: its name, how it is drawn, which ticket queues it counts, whether monitoring alert tickets count, which partner it covers, how it breaks down, its target and its colour bands, already filled in from the industry benchmark. Any shape the tile's data cannot fill is greyed out with the reason, so you never add a tile that would sit empty. Add to dashboard writes it, and the board lets you move tiles and resize them in both directions. Close the step with changes you have not added and Current asks first.

Every tile keeps a small menu in its corner with two edit doors and nothing else that edits: Refine with AI (say what to change, in words, such as show me the last six months) and Edit tile, which opens everything about the tile in one panel. Beside them sit Move to section, Refresh now, Duplicate and Delete, plus See the rows where the tile can open its records and Mark verified on a tile Current worked out for itself. Duplicating a tile Current worked out for itself always hands you an unverified copy, so the sign-off belongs to a number a person checked rather than to a row that got copied.

If you are looking at a dashboard somebody shared with you and cannot edit it, every tile carries a What this tile counts button instead. It is read only and it shows the same facts an editor sees: the queues, the monitoring setting, the partner scope, the breakdown, the window, the benchmark and when the number was last read. When it could not read something, it says so rather than guessing.

Note
A tile's name has to match what the tile counts
Name a tile whatever you like, with two guardrails, because the name is what stays on the board and what a TV shows across the room. A timeframe in the name comes back out: the bar at the top already sets the dates, so a name that repeats them goes stale the moment somebody moves the bar, and Current tells you when it has taken those words out. And on a tile Current builds for you, the name is checked against the number underneath it. When Current tried to point a tile at one partner and could not, that name comes back out of the title, and when those are the words that left, Current names the exact value it could not use. A name that claims to count something the tile does not count is replaced with the plain name of the number. A heading that says one thing while the number says another is the one kind of wrong that looks right. What Current will not do is rename your heading on a hunch. Where nothing was attempted and the words carry no proof a partner was meant, an everyday name like Tickets closed for hardware is left exactly as you wrote it, because an ordinary word and a partner's name look the same, and guessing wrong would mean telling you something untrue about your own words.

See the rows behind a number

A number you cannot open is a number you have to take on faith. So most tiles open: click the number, a bar, or See the rows on the tile menu, and a panel lists the records the tile counted, with sortable columns and a CSV export. Time and task tiles list their entries for anyone who can see them in the app. Ticket rows follow the CRM wall: if your role does not include CRM access you still get every count, but the row list stays closed. The panel tells you plainly when a list is capped or measures something slightly different from the tile, so the two never quietly disagree.

One definition per number, and where to read it

Words like first response, reactive, endpoint, billable and won deal mean slightly different things at different shops, and in most reporting tools they end up meaning slightly different things on two tiles of the same board. In Current each of those words is defined once, in one place, and every tile draws its wording from there. So the sentence under a number on your laptop, the same sentence in Present mode, the same sentence on a lobby TV and the explanation in What this tile counts are all the same sentence, because they are the same sentence.

You can read the definitions behind any tile without being able to edit it. Open What this tile counts from the tile menu and there is a section called How Current defines this, one plain line per term the number is built on: which day the workspace counts, which clock a response time was measured on, which queues count as project work, what makes a ticket reactive, what an endpoint is and which RMM it came from. Alongside it, as before, are the queues, the partner scope, the window, the colours and the freshness for that particular tile.

Open About this number on any tile and, above the notes, How it's calculated states the arithmetic in plain words while How to read it says what a high or low number means and what to check before acting. The same two sections appear in What this tile counts. Each definition also records what it deliberately leaves out and why. Reactive hours leave out tickets your monitoring raised by itself and the queues an admin marked as project work. Hours logged leave out time a manager rejected and time your PSA voided before invoicing. Endpoints leave out network gear, and a machine two of your tools both manage is counted once, with the tile saying how many were counted in more than one system. An exclusion with no reason written next to it is indistinguishable from a bug, so every one of them carries its reason.

Note
Where an MSP could reasonably measure it another way, we say so
Some of these are genuine judgement calls. First response can be averaged over the tickets opened in the window, which is what Current does, or over the tickets that were answered in it, which quietly hides every ticket nobody has answered yet. Utilization can divide by the hours people logged or by the hours they had available, and those are different numbers wearing one word. Current picks one, prints which one on the tile, and keeps a note of the alternative beside its own definition, so the choice is something you can see rather than something you have to reverse engineer from the number.

Targets, color bands, and benchmarks

A number on its own asks you to remember what good looks like. So tiles can carry a target and colour bands: green when a number is where you want it, amber when it drifts, red when it crosses the line. For service desk staples Current applies the industry benchmark on its own, and names the source right on the tile: SLA compliance at 95 percent, CSAT at 97, first response under an hour. Open Edit tile on the tile menu to set your own numbers, or switch bands off. A value with no band stays neutral. Colours never guess.

The AI also groups tiles into named sections as your dashboard grows. Rename a section, dissolve it, or send a tile to another section from its own menu, and the layout is yours.

Change what a tile counts, without the AI

Every tile has two edit buttons in its menu, and they do different jobs. Refine with AI is the one you already know: describe the change and the AI rebuilds the tile. Edit tile is the other door. It shows you the tile's real inputs as ordinary controls with the tile drawn live beside them, and it never talks to a model unless you ask it to. It used to be three separate doors (Edit data, Edit thresholds and target, and Rename) with three separate saves. It is one panel now, everything is in it, the tile redraws as you change it, and one save writes the lot. Refine with AI is still its own menu entry, and it is also a box inside this panel, so you can describe a change without leaving.

On a tile that counts tickets, the first thing you see is your own ticket queues as a checkbox list, with each queue's name and how many tickets are in it, so you can untick the ones this tile should leave out. Under that is a checkbox for whether tickets your monitoring raised automatically should count. Every ticket tile has counted them from the start and said so on its face; this is the switch that note promised. Below that you choose whether the tile shows one number or breaks it down, and how it is drawn, and below that again its name, its target and its colour bands. A tile Current composed itself gets the same panel, and it says plainly that the editor for its own data is the AI.

Before you save, the panel tells you in one plain sentence what your change will do to the number and which way it moves. Untick three queues and it says the number gets smaller, names how many tickets stop being counted, and says all of that before anything is written.

Two things the panel will not let you do. If you switch a leaderboard, donut, bar or table to one number with no breakdown, the shape it was using has nothing left to rank or slice, so the panel says which shape the tile becomes and saves that instead of leaving you a tile that reads empty forever. And while no queue is ticked, Save is switched off rather than accepting the click and answering with an error, because the panel already told you to tick one.

Note
You only ever see controls this number can honestly use
There is no queue picker on a tile that does not read tickets, and no breakdown offered that the number cannot be split by. An option that saves and then changes nothing is worse than no option at all. A queue you have switched off under Integrations stays off whatever a tile asks for, so those are listed with the reason rather than offered as a choice. Your queue scope sticks to the tile, so it survives a refresh, a reload, Present mode and a lobby TV, and the tile's footnote changes to say which queues it counts instead of claiming it counts them all. Dashboards you already have keep the exact numbers they show today until somebody opens this panel and changes one.

Arrange the board

A dashboard is a twelve column grid, so a tile has a width as well as a height. Grab the grip in a tile's top left corner to move it. To resize, hover the tile and pull any of the eight handles: the four edges or the four corners. The tile keeps drawing its number while you size it, and a dashed outline shows you exactly where it will land and how big it will be before you let go. Widths and heights snap to the grid, and the board closes its own gaps: when one tile grows, its neighbour slides sideways into free space on the same row rather than dropping down and leaving a hole. A dashboard you arranged before the grid arrived keeps every tile's width and height, but its rows now pack upwards, so a short tile beside a tall one rises to fill the gap instead of leaving dead space. No number changes.

You can do all of it without a mouse. Tab to a tile's grip and press Enter. Arrow keys then move the tile, Shift with an arrow key resizes it, Escape puts it back where it was, and every step is read out. On a phone or a tablet the board becomes one column in the order you saved, and each tile carries a move up button, a move down button and a height bar under it, so you can arrange the board by touch. Moving a tile there rearranges the whole board without losing the widths you set on a laptop.

Note
Rearranging a shared dashboard is safe for everyone else
A dashboard's arrangement is shared, but what each person can see is not: a tile whose numbers your role does not reach is hidden from you entirely. It still holds its slot, so you see an empty space where it sits rather than a locked box, and nothing you move on that board can move it. That is deliberate. The alternative, tidying the gap away on your screen, meant your own edits were then saved against the tidied arrangement, and one person making a tile slightly taller could silently re-order three of a colleague's tiles. A gap you can see is a much smaller price. Tables and leaderboards also refuse to be squeezed narrower than their own columns, so a value can never end up cut in half.

How a tile reads

A tile sizes itself to the space it has, and so does everything drawn inside it. Make a tile bigger and the gauge dial, the donut, the chart, the leaderboard rows and the big number all grow with it; make it smaller and they shrink to fit rather than spilling over the edge. The big number keeps a readable floor on a narrow tile, so nothing is ever too small to read, and a large money figure on a very narrow tile shortens to something like $47.6M rather than being cut off halfway through a digit, with the exact number on hover. Below a certain size a tile draws a simpler version of itself rather than a squashed one: a narrow gauge moves its verdict badge up beside the number, and a tile too short for a dial draws the same value against its target as a bar instead. Long names shorten to a single line and the whole name is on hover. A table or a leaderboard never draws wider than the tile it sits in. Leaderboard rows are one line each, with the person's initials, their place, and a bar behind the figure showing how they compare, and a tile shows as many rows as it has room for and says how many it is not showing. Leaderboards number their ranks with a proper tie rule, so three people on the same count all show first and the next person shows fourth.

A tile's notes live behind About this number, at the bottom of the tile beside the dates it covers. Every caveat a number carries is still there, in the same words: which queues it counts, which clock it measured on, how the board is sorted, what was left out. They are one click away instead of stacked under the figure, so the tile reads as a number rather than a paragraph. Open it once and it stays open on every tile, and on every device you sign in from, so if you would rather always see them you only say so once.

Three things never hide behind that control, because they change what the number means: a warning that Current could not refresh this and is showing the last figure it read, a note that Current cannot yet confirm a security product has ever sent data, and the caveat on a tile Current composed itself. And where a hidden note would change how you read the figure, the tile leaves a short word on its face, such as includes alerts or adjusted. Click that word and the notes open. On a lobby TV nothing is hidden either, since there is nobody there to click: a note that applies to several tiles at once prints one time, in the strip along the bottom of the screen, and a note that belongs to one tile stays on that tile.

Colour is never the only signal on a dashboard. Where a tile carries a good, watch or at-risk verdict, it also shows a shape and the word, so the verdict survives colour blindness, a greyscale print and a washed out screen across the room. Hover the mark and it tells you the rule that produced it. On a bar or a trend chart the same rule applies: each threshold line prints its own rule in words, a toned bar carries a texture as well as a colour, and hovering a bar tells you the verdict behind it. Hover any chart and you get the date or the category, every series by name, and the value with its unit, plus its share of the total where that helps. A slice too small to round to a whole percent reads as under one percent, never as zero.

Motion means something here, and there is exactly one moment worth watching: the gauge arc sweeping up to its value while the number counts, with the verdict badge arriving a beat later. Everything else simply arrives. Tiles come in reading order, bars grow, and it is all over inside six tenths of a second. When a number changes, the tile eases to the new one so the change is visible. When a read fails, everything stops: the last good number stays on screen, the tile says so in words, and nothing re-animates, because a number that re-animates looks like a number that just arrived. If you have asked your computer to reduce motion, nothing moves and every number is correct on the very first frame.

Service desk gauges

The catalog covers the service desk: tickets opened, tickets closed, tickets closed by person, average first response, average resolution time, SLA compliance, the age of what is open right now, and opened versus closed day by day so you can see whether the desk is gaining or losing ground. Response and SLA gauges measure tickets that have closed; a ticket still open past its target shows up once it resolves. Assignment comes straight from your PSA, and a ticket nobody owns is counted as Unassigned rather than credited to anyone.

Which of these you are offered depends on the PSA you run, because a ticket number is only ever as good as what your PSA sends Current. Rather than draw a tile that would sit on zero forever, Current leaves that number out of the suggestions and says why if you ask for it.

Service desk numberWhich PSA sends Current what it needs
Tickets opened, tickets closed, tickets open right now, tickets closed by person, average resolution time, open ticket aging, opened versus closedAutotask or ConnectWise
Average first response, SLA complianceAutotask only. ConnectWise does not send a first response time or an SLA verdict, and Current will not guess one.
Any ticket number on HaloPSANone yet. HaloPSA syncs your projects and time, but not its service tickets, so ticket gauges are held back until it does.
Note
A held-back number is the honest answer
A zero on a wall screen reads as a quiet week, not as a missing feed, which is why Current would rather offer you nothing than offer you that. Everything else in the catalog is unaffected: projects, hours, tasks, budget, capacity and the whole CRM are Current's own numbers and work whichever PSA you run. A ticket gauge you built before this change stays on your dashboard, so if you run HaloPSA and one of them has been sitting on zero, that is the reason, and it is worth taking off the board until HaloPSA ticket sync lands.

Projects and sales are covered too: projects over budget, pipeline broken down by stage, deals expected to close this quarter using the same weighted rule as the Forecast report, and how long open deals have been sitting. Sales tiles follow the same access rules as the rest of the CRM.

Put it on the office TV

Present mode fills the screen with your tiles, scaled for reading across the room, and rotates between dashboards when you pick more than one. For a screen with no keyboard, an admin can mint a TV link from the dashboard menu: a private URL any smart TV opens with no login. The link shows only tiles everyone on the team can see, tiles grouped by partner stay off it so partner names never appear on an unattended screen, and it is shown once at creation. Revoke it any time and the screen goes dark within a minute.

The screen's orientation matters too. A TV mounted sideways, portrait style, gets its own layout: fewer, wider tiles stacked taller, with full-size gauges instead of squeezed ones. Rotate the screen and the board reflows on its own, without a reload, in Present mode and on the TV link alike. Text on a wall screen never drops below a size you can read from across the room, whichever way the screen is turned.

Wall screens open in dark by default, both in Present mode and on a TV link, because a bright white board in a dim office is the thing people ask us to turn down first. In Present mode there is a sun and moon control in the bar at the bottom of the screen, so whoever is driving can switch that session to light without changing anything on their own desk. A TV link has nobody standing at it, so it takes its instruction from the address instead: add ?theme=light to the end of the link and that screen stays light. Anything else on the end of the link is ignored and the screen stays dark, so a typo can never leave a lobby TV blank.

Light or dark, and where the switch lives

Dashboards can be light or dark and you pick which. The sun and moon control sits in the dashboards toolbar, on the right, next to the dashboard name. It changes the dashboards page only: your sidebar, your projects, the CRM and every other screen stay exactly as they were. The choice follows you rather than the machine, so switching to dark on your laptop means the board is dark when you next open it on another computer.

Nothing about the numbers changes with the theme. The same tiles, the same figures, the same explanations under each one. Colors were rechecked for readability in both, so the arcs, bars and chart labels stay legible in dark rather than fading into the background, and the light board looks exactly as it did before.

Hero tiles, and choosing which tiles get one

A hero tile is a deep ink card with the figure in big type, its change and its trend line sitting underneath. It is what turns a board into a cockpit: two or three numbers that are plainly the headline, with the supporting tiles reading as ordinary cards below them. Hero tiles look the same in light and dark, so a board reads the same way whichever theme you are in.

By default Current decides by size. Make a number tile large enough and it becomes a hero tile; make it smaller again and it goes back to an ordinary card. That works well until you resize a tile to fit a row and its look changes as a side effect, which is why you can also just say what you want.

Open the tile menu, choose Edit tile, and look for Tile style. It offers three answers. Automatic is the default and behaves exactly as described above: big tiles get the dark hero look. Always hero keeps the dark look whatever size the tile is. Standard card keeps it an ordinary card however big you make it. Once you pick Always hero or Standard card, resizing the tile never changes its look again.

Note
What the setting does and does not touch
Tile style changes which card the figure is drawn on and nothing else. The number, the timeframe, the queues it counts and the explanation under it are all untouched. It is offered only on single-number tiles and gauges, because a leaderboard, a table or a chart cannot be drawn on the dark band and Current does not offer a setting that would change nothing. On a very small tile Always hero falls back to an ordinary card too: the hero look needs room to read.

The ready-made dashboards under Start from a set already name their own headline tiles this way, so a starter board opens as a couple of big numbers over dense supporting rows rather than a screen of identical dark tiles. Your choice also survives a refine: ask Current to change a tile and the style you picked stays, the same way your queue and timeframe choices do.

The explain caret is unchanged. About this number still sits under every tile, in both themes and at every tile size, and still opens How it's calculated and How to read it.

Where the number comes from, and why some carry an asterisk

Current builds a tile one of two ways, and the difference is worth knowing before you put one on a screen in the office.

First it looks in a vetted catalog: numbers an engineer wrote, named, and tested, covering four families. Service desk (tickets opened and closed, satisfaction when CrewHu is connected). Sales and CRM (open pipeline, won deals, won value, activity, by rep). Projects and time (hours logged, tasks completed, overdue work, budget used, your own hours). Security and devices (phishing caught, open alerts, backups failing, device compliance, warranties running out). A catalog tile is plain: a person wrote that query and it is covered by tests.

If nothing in the catalog fits what you asked for, Current neither refuses nor fakes it. It works the number out from your own data, and it tells you that is what it did.

Heads up
The asterisk is the point
A tile Current worked out for itself carries a permanent footnote: AI-computed metric. Verify this number against your source before relying on it. That is not false modesty. A number nobody has checked against the system it came from is not a number to put in front of a partner. Check it against your PSA, or against the matching Reports lens for the same date range, then use Mark verified on the tile menu. The footnote then reads Verified by, with your name and the date, and the asterisk stays, so whoever reads the dashboard next month can still tell what kind of number they are looking at.
Note
The AI designs the tile, it never fetches your data
The AI decides what to draw and how. Every number on the dashboard is then read by your own browser session, under your own permissions, exactly like the rest of the app. So a tile can never show you a row you would not otherwise be allowed to see: the worst a bad design can do is come back empty.

The timeframe bar

One bar across the top drives every tile below it: Today, Week, Month, Quarter, and Year, plus trailing 7, 30, and 90 days and any custom range you pick on the calendar. Change it and the whole dashboard recomputes together, so two tiles can never quote different windows at each other. Your choice is remembered for next time, per person.

Note
Some numbers are right now, not a range
A few numbers only make sense as of this moment: tickets open right now, backups currently failing, devices out of compliance. Those tiles say "Right now, doesn't follow the timeframe above" under the number instead of pretending the timeframe changed them.

A tile can also keep a window of its own. Open Edit tile and pick a timeframe there, say Last 30 days, and that tile stays on it while the rest of the board follows the bar at the top. The tile's own scope line prints the window it actually used, so a pinned tile can never be mistaken for one following the bar, and the pin survives a refresh, Present mode and the TV link, where the tile's stamp names its window too. Tiles that only exist as of this moment offer no timeframe control at all.

One time zone, one meaning of a day

Every window on a dashboard is cut in your workspace's time zone: today, this week, this month, this quarter. That is set once, in Settings under Integrations, in the Workspace basics section. It starts on the zone Current already used to time notifications and the lead response clock, so you do not have to touch it. Some numbers did move the day it shipped: the forecast tile and the Reports Pipeline, Forecast, MRR movement and AE scorecard lenses used to cut their months and quarters at UTC midnight, so on any workspace outside UTC a deal that closed late on the last evening of a month could sit in the wrong month. It now sits in yours. Only a tenant admin can change the zone, the card shows what the clock reads there before they save, and every change is written to the audit log.

It matters because a day has to mean the same thing to everyone reading the same tile. Before this, a dashboard built its window at the clock of whoever was looking, the forecast tile counted in UTC, and a TV board used the clock of the screen it played on. A project manager in Grand Rapids and an engineer overseas could open one saved tile and read two different numbers, with nothing on the tile to explain why.

So every tile prints its calendar under the number, next to the window it covers, and so does the Reports header and every report you print. A TV board prints the window it is showing and whose calendar it belongs to, along the bottom.

Note
Changing the zone changes numbers at the edges
A different zone cuts every window on a different midnight, so counts right at the start or end of a window will move, and so will the daily points on a trend. Totals in the middle of a window do not move. The setting says what it will do before you save, and warns you that a TV board that is already live will follow on its next refresh.

Response times, measured on the hours you actually work

Average first response and average resolution time can be measured two ways, and it is your choice. On the working hours setting, only the hours your desk is open count: nights, weekends and your holidays are left out. On the round the clock setting, it is plain elapsed time. Every workspace starts on elapsed time, so nothing changed for you on the day this shipped.

It matters because every published response time figure in this industry is measured on open hours, including the one Current itself shows on the first response tile, which is 60 minutes. Measure the wall clock instead and a desk that works business hours can never reach it: a ticket that arrives at 5pm on Friday and is answered at 9am on Monday scores 3,840 minutes, when on an eight to five desk it took one working hour. On Autotask it was worse, because Autotask works its own SLA due times out against your SLA calendar, so a green SLA compliance tile could sit right beside a red first response tile off the same tickets.

You set it once, in Settings under Integrations, in the Workspace basics section: when the desk opens, when it closes, which days it works, or that you work around the clock. Your holidays come from the list you already keep under Holidays, the same one the project scheduler skips, so the two can never disagree about a day off. Each of those two tiles says under its number which of the two clocks it counted on, in the app, in Present mode and on a TV board, so a figure nobody can place is never on screen. Only a tenant admin can change it, every change is written to the audit log, and a schedule that cannot be true, such as a closing time earlier than the opening time or no working days at all, is refused before it can be saved. One schedule covers the whole workspace rather than one per partner.

Note
Turning on working hours makes those two numbers smaller
Usually two to three times smaller for an eight to five desk, and tiles that read red today can turn green. That is the correction, not a break. Nothing else moves: ticket counts, open ticket aging and the trend charts are not on this clock. A desk that genuinely works around the clock is measured as elapsed time and keeps its holidays counted, because it works them.

A response time leaderboard reads fastest first

Break average first response or average resolution time down by person, queue or partner and the board ranks fastest first. Rank 1 is your quickest responder. That is the opposite of every other leaderboard in Current, where the biggest number wins, so the tile says under its number that it is ranked fastest first. It is not a setting: on a number where lower is better there is only one honest order, and asking to reverse it gets you a plain answer saying so rather than a tile that quietly does nothing.

Every row says how many tickets it is an average of, because that is usually the difference between a slow week and a slow technician. A row built on fewer than five tickets is shown below the ranked rows without a rank and says so, so a 0.0 off two tickets can never sit at the top of the board. Nobody is dropped: a name that vanishes off a board is worse than a name with a small number beside it. When the board is showing eight of twenty five, it now tells you how many it is not showing.

Note
New response time tiles leave monitoring alerts out
A monitoring alert is acknowledged automatically within seconds, so counting those in a response time average measures your RMM rather than your desk. Tiles you build from now on leave them out and say so. Tiles you already have keep counting them and keep saying so on their face, so nothing on your wall changed overnight. Either way you can switch it under Edit tile on the tile menu.
Note
SLA compliance is not on this clock, on purpose
That number is your PSA's own verdict on each ticket, worked out against its own due times, which already follow the partner's SLA calendar and priority tiers. Current never works it out again from a clock of its own, so this setting has no effect on it and your dashboard keeps agreeing with your partner's own SLA report.

The four MSP gauges

Four numbers most managed service providers run their week on now have proper tiles, each built on one server side read and each one honest about what it could not measure.

  • Reactive ticket hours per endpoint, the number usually called RHEM. The hours your team logged on service tickets, divided by the workstations and servers your RMM manages, reported as a monthly rate. Under about half an hour per endpoint per month is the industry bar. Ask for it by name, or pick the starter suggestion.
  • Endpoints per partner. Your managed fleet, per partner, counted from every RMM this workspace has connected.
  • Managed services margin. A month of recurring revenue, less the cost of the reactive service desk work that served it. Tenant admins only, because it is built on cost rates.
  • Effective hourly rate. The same month of recurring revenue divided by the reactive hours worked in it, so you can see what a flat fee agreement really pays per hour. Tenant admins only.

Reactive means service tickets people asked for. Tickets your monitoring raised automatically are left out, and so are the queues an admin marked as project work under Integrations, so project time never lands in a service number.

Note
These four wait for your PSA's ticket time
All four read the time your technicians log on service tickets, from Autotask, ConnectWise or HaloPSA. Until that time has synced for your workspace, the tiles say so in a sentence and show no number. That matters most on the two money tiles: recurring revenue with no hours beside it works out to a perfect margin, and a perfect margin off missing data is exactly the number Current will not print.
Note
Every RMM you run, named on the tile, and an Unmapped line you can always see
An endpoint is a workstation or a server one of your RMMs has an agent on. Network gear is not one. Every RMM you have connected counts automatically, with nothing to set up: the Windows fleet in one tool and the Macs in another simply add up, and the tile names the systems it counted. A machine that two tools both manage is counted once where Current can match it, and the tile says how many were counted in more than one system, so an overlap is disclosed instead of hidden. ScalePad asset records can also be chosen as a source by hand, but never join automatically, because an asset register can hold a retired machine no agent ever saw. Endpoints that are not matched to a partner always show as an Unmapped line: that number is what tells you whether a per partner figure can be trusted yet. Only a workspace with no device source connected at all sees a refusal instead of a number.
Note
Same day time entry decides whether RHEM can be trusted
The tile prints how much of the time in it was entered on the day the work happened. Above about 90 percent the number is a measurement. Below that it is a floor, because the missing write ups are still coming, and the tile says exactly that instead of letting a flattering number stand.
Note
Hours with no cost rate are never treated as free
Cost comes from each person's hourly cost, which Current syncs from your PSA. If somebody worked reactive hours and Current holds no cost rate for them, a subcontractor for instance, those hours are counted and named as unpriced hours on the tile face, and the margin tile tells you it reads higher than the truth because of them. They are never valued at zero. Margin also covers reactive labor only: tools, licenses, subscriptions and project work are not in it, so it is not a full gross margin and never claims to be.
Note
The margin tiles need a one month timeframe
Recurring revenue is a monthly figure, so comparing it against half a month of work would read as roughly double the margin you earned. Set the tile to Last month, or a custom range covering a full month, and the tile asks you to do that rather than publishing the mismatch. Margin history starts from the day this shipped and is never filled in backwards, because a March margin worked out with today's cost rates would not be March's margin.

SLA compliance now shows what it is based on

The SLA tile prints its own denominator, in the form "based on 14 of 3,902 resolved tickets": the first number is how many of your resolved tickets carried an SLA verdict from your PSA at all, and the second is how many were resolved in the window. When fewer than twenty carried a verdict, the percentage is hidden and a sentence takes its place, because a green 100 percent off three tickets is not a fact about your desk. Break the tile down by partner, queue or person and the same floor applies to each row, with anything left out counted on the tile face. A TV board applies the same floor too, so a lobby screen can never show a percentage your laptop is hiding.

Your dashboard, and the team's

Every dashboard starts personal. It is yours, nobody else sees it, and you can keep as many as you like: one for your morning check, another for the week you build business reviews.

Project managers and tenant admins can also publish a shared dashboard the whole team sees. A shared dashboard has one layout, so its tiles stay where its editors put them and everyone else reads it as published. Creating, renaming, sharing, unsharing, and deleting all live in the dashboard switcher at the top of the lens. Sharing asks you to confirm first, because it is the one action that widens who can read your numbers.

Who sees which numbers

The dashboard opens no side doors. It mirrors the walls Reports already has, and the database enforces them underneath, not the interface.

The kind of numberWho can see it
Your own work and your portfolio: your hours, tasks, tickets, project health, budget usedEveryone who can open Dashboards
Cross-person numbers: hours by person, utilization, staff leaderboardsProject managers and tenant admins
Cost and margin: managed services margin, effective hourly rateTenant admins only, because both are built on the cost rates only an admin can read. The Profitability lens still covers the rest.
Anything from the CRM: pipeline, deals, won revenue, sales activityAnyone with CRM access
Anything at all on a dashboard or in ReportsStaff only. Partners never see Dashboards or Reports.
Note
Ask for something you cannot see, and it says so kindly
If your role cannot see the data behind a request, Current tells you that in a sentence instead of drawing an empty tile or, worse, a wrong one. On a shared dashboard, a tile whose data sits behind a wall you are not through is simply not shown to you, rather than teased as locked.

How fresh is that number?

Each tile stamps how long ago it last read your data and refreshes itself about every 90 seconds while the page is open. That is how fresh the tile is. How fresh the data underneath is depends on the system it came from, and Current never claims to be fresher than its source. Hover the stamp and it names the cadence behind that tile.

Where the number comes fromHow often it refreshes
Current's own projects, phases, tasks, time entries, and to-dosAs you save it. This data lives in Current.
Your PSA: ConnectWise, Autotask, or HaloPSAEvery 5 minutes
CRM email and meetings from Microsoft 365Email every 5 minutes, meetings every 15
CrewHu satisfaction surveysEvery 15 minutes
ScalePad Lifecycle Manager: assets, warranty, budgetsHourly
Device, security, and backup mirrors: Datto RMM, ConnectWise RMM, Datto Backup, Datto EDR, RocketCyber, Auvik, AddigyEvery 6 hours
ConnectBooster and BNG PaymentsDaily
Inky email threatsAs they happen. Inky pushes each event to Current.

When it says an integration has to be connected

Ask for a number Current cannot reach and it will not guess and will not draw an empty tile. It names the integration that holds the data, says why that data is needed, and points you at Settings → Integrations. Here is the path from there:

  1. 1
    Read which integration it named
    A satisfaction tile needs CrewHu. A phishing tile needs Inky. A warranty tile needs ScalePad Lifecycle Manager. Current names the one it needs rather than saying no data.
  2. 2
    Connect it
    Settings → Integrations, find that card, and follow it through. Connecting an integration is a tenant admin action, so if that is not you, send them the name of the card.
  3. 3
    Give it one sync cycle
    A freshly connected integration has nothing in Current until its first sync lands. Use the table above for how long that is, or press Sync now on the card where it offers one.
  4. 4
    Ask again
    The sample prompts and everything Current will build widen on their own the moment a connection is live. Nothing to turn on for the dashboard itself.
Note
New integrations join the catalog automatically
When Current ships a new integration, its numbers arrive in the dashboard catalog with it. That is enforced by a build test rather than by somebody remembering, so the tile library keeps pace with the platform.

Waiting on data, a failed read, and a partial read

A safety tile will never tell you everything is fine when Current does not know. Backups failing, EDR alerts open, SOC incidents and phishing caught are the four that matter most here, and each one now says which of these three it is hitting:

  1. 1
    Waiting on the first data
    The product is connected but has never sent Current a record yet, so the tile says it is waiting on the first data from that product and names it. It fills in on its own with the first sync. This is the difference between a real zero and an empty feed, and Current keeps them apart by remembering the first record each product ever delivered.
  2. 2
    The read failed
    A tile that already had a number keeps showing it, prints "Couldn't refresh this. Showing the last number Current read." underneath, and lets the Updated stamp in its header keep aging so you can see how long it has been. A tile that never got a number says it could not read this one. Either way it retries by itself about every 90 seconds.
  3. 3
    Only part of it could be read
    On a very large fleet a tile can hit its reading limit. It then says the number would be incomplete rather than showing a smaller one, and points you at Settings, under Integrations, to check that the product is syncing.

Devices compliant follows the same rule and goes one step further. If any RMM you have connected cannot be read, it refuses the whole percentage instead of publishing the RMMs that did answer, because a Mac-only 100 percent over thousands of unmeasured Windows machines reads as good news. It also prints how many devices actually reported an answer, and says on its face when it is mixing Windows patch compliance from Datto RMM or ConnectWise RMM with Mac policy compliance from Addigy, since those are two different checks.

Note
Ticket tiles include monitoring alerts
Every ticket tile counts the tickets your monitoring raises automatically as well as the ones people asked for, and says so in its notes. Open About this number at the bottom of the tile to read them. Because that one changes how the count should be read, the tile also leaves the words includes alerts on its face, so you can see it without opening anything. If your RMM opens hundreds of alert tickets a month, that is why a count reads higher than it feels. You can change which queues a tile counts under Edit tile.

The same rule on every tile, not only the safety ones

A failed read and a genuinely quiet week used to look identical on a money tile as well. Open pipeline value, Deals won, Won revenue, Won revenue by rep, Quotes won and CRM activities logged all went quiet when their read timed out or was refused, so a tile could read as though nothing was won while the read behind it was failing. They now report the failure instead, and the whole tile library follows one rule: an empty tile means the query ran and matched nothing. Anything else says what went wrong.

  • The could-not-refresh line described above is not only for safety tiles. Any tile that keeps a number through a failed read prints it, in amber, and it now shows in the app, in Present mode and on a TV screen, because a wall screen is where a frozen number does the most damage.
  • A tile with no earlier number to keep says it could not read this one, instead of showing a zero.
  • No tile puts database wording on its face. A read that takes too long says it took too long and that Current will try again in a moment; the technical detail goes to the browser console, where an engineer can find it.
  • An empty tile is worded for the kind of tile it is. A right-now tile no longer says there was no data in this window, because it has no window: it says there is nothing to show right now and points you at refining what it counts. A tile with a timeframe says nothing matched that timeframe.
Note
Tiles you built by asking carry their own caveat
A tile Current composed straight off a table is run exactly as written, so it can sit beside a ready-made tile answering the same question with a bigger number. Rather than quietly changing what you asked for, the tile now says what it includes. One read off your time entries says that time a manager rejected and time your PSA voided are still in the number, so it can read higher than the Hours tiles and the Budget report. One read off the ticket mirror says it counts every synced ticket, including monitoring alerts and any queues switched off under Integrations. Refine the tile to leave them out if that is what you meant.

ConnectWise workspaces: closed tickets and who did the work

Two things about a ConnectWise service ticket were read wrongly, and correcting them moves ticket numbers in both directions at once. Autotask and HaloPSA workspaces are not affected.

  1. 1
    A closed ticket now counts as closed
    Current used to treat a ticket as closed only when ConnectWise had stamped a close time. Any ticket ConnectWise considered finished without one stayed open forever, so Tickets open now and all four aging buckets read too high, Tickets closed read too low, and the opened versus closed chart showed a backlog that only ever grew. Current now trusts ConnectWise's own closed flag. Where there is no close time it uses the ticket's last update as the closing moment, and the tile says so under the number, because a resolution time built that way is an upper limit rather than a measurement.
  2. 2
    Tickets closed by person now measures the person it was dispatched to
    It used to measure the ticket owner. ConnectWise desks dispatch work by assigned resource and often never set an owner, which is why that leaderboard was mostly Unassigned. It now reads the dispatched resource and takes the name from your own resource list, so bars move, some names appear for the first time, and the owner is used only on a ticket with nobody dispatched. A ticket dispatched to somebody Current has not synced yet stays under Unassigned rather than being credited to the wrong person.
  3. 3
    Current re-reads the last 24 months once
    Tickets already stored have to be re-read for the corrections to reach them, so Current walks the last 24 months of ConnectWise tickets one time, a chunk at a time across your normal syncs. Numbers settle over a few hours to a few days depending on how many tickets you have. Nothing is deleted and nothing needs switching on.
Note
It is not only the dashboard
The same open and closed truth feeds the Tickets chip on a company, the ticket figures in a Strategic Business Review, the AI company insights, whitespace signals and the renewal dossier. Those all change with it, so a review you exported last month will not match one you export today. The new figures are the right ones.

When Current cannot draw the number at all

Connecting something is not always the answer, and Current will not pretend it is. Some numbers are not in Current at any price yet, because the data behind them never arrives from anywhere: technician utilization, first contact resolution, escalation rate, quote win rate, blended gross margin, revenue per technician. Ask for one of those and Current says in one plain sentence what it does not hold and why, rather than sending you to Settings to connect an integration that would not have helped. Reactive hours per endpoint used to be on this list and is not any more: Current now mirrors your PSA's service ticket time, so it draws that number for real. See The four MSP gauges above.

Then it offers the nearest numbers it can genuinely draw, as buttons you can click straight into the box. Every suggestion is checked against your own permissions and what your workspace has connected before it is offered, so what you are shown is a tile Current will really build. If none of them clears those walls for you, Current says so plainly instead of showing an empty row.

What you asked forWhy Current does not hold it, and what it offers instead
Cost to serve one device, profit per endpointCurrent now holds reactive service ticket time and your RMM fleet, so it draws reactive ticket hours per endpoint and managed services margin. A cost or profit figure for a single device is not one of them: costs land on a person's hours, not on a machine. Offers reactive ticket hours per endpoint and managed services margin.
Technician utilization, billable share of capacityCurrent holds project time only and does not record whether an hour was billable, so the percentage would be missing the service desk. Offers hours by person and billable share.
First contact resolution, touches per ticketCurrent mirrors the ticket, not the notes and time entries on it, so a touch cannot be counted. Offers average resolution time and open ticket aging.
Quote win rateOnly won quotes reach Current, so the rate would always read 100 percent. Offers deals won and won revenue.
Blended gross margin, revenue per technician, MFA coverageCurrent holds no invoices, no billed revenue, no employment class, and no directory access inside a partner's tenant, so a margin across everything you sell cannot be worked out. Managed services margin is the honest slice it can draw: recurring revenue less the reactive labor that served it. Offers managed services margin, won revenue, hours by person, and the device and email security numbers you do have.
Heads up
Never a connect prompt for something connecting would not fix
The two are different answers and Current keeps them apart. A missing integration is a door you can open: connect CrewHu and satisfaction tiles appear. A number Current does not hold is not a door, and saying "connect an integration" there sends you shopping for a product that cannot solve your problem. A ticket number on HaloPSA and first response or SLA compliance on ConnectWise sit in the second group: they are held back because your PSA does not send Current what those numbers need, not because you are missing a purchase.
